Tornado Watch Issued for Counties West of St. Louis
A tornado watch has been issued for counties located west of St. Louis on Friday evening.

St. Louis, MO, July 31, 2026 —
A tornado watch has been issued for several counties situated to the west of St. Louis, effective for Friday evening. This alert signifies that conditions are favorable for the development of tornadoes in the specified region.
Residents in the affected areas are advised to stay informed about weather updates and to be prepared for potential severe weather. A tornado watch means that tornadoes are possible, and individuals should have a plan in place should a warning be issued.
